Six teachers sat down for lunch at the round table in the faculty room. Ms. Bailey sat between the science teacher and the math teacher. Mr. Vollert, the math teacher, sat between the music teacher and Ms. Bailey. The ELA teacher sat next to the science teacher. The science teacher sat between the Spanish teacher and Mrs. Strain. Mr. Holman isn't a writer. Mrs. Karels cannot carry a tune, but she sat between Ms. Merridy and Mrs. Strain, one of which is very musical.
Directions: Use the diagram to the right to figure out where each teacher sat at the faculty room table. Write their name and what subject they teach on the correct chair. Use the bottom of this page to brainstorm!

Explanation:
We are told from the very beginning that Mr. Vollert is the Math teacher. Therefore none of the other teachers can teach math. We know that Mrs. Bailey sits beside the science teacher and Mr. Vollert (Math). Mr. Vollert (Math) sits beside Mrs. Bailey and the music teacher. Therefore, Mrs. Bailey can be neither the music teacher nor the science teacher. The ELA teacher sits beside the Science teacher. The Science teacher sits between the Spanish teacher and Mrs. Strain. Meaning Mrs. Strain cannot be the Spanish teacher, so she has to be the ELA teacher. Mr. Holman isn't a writer, which means he doesn't teach ELA. Mrs. Karels cannot carry a tune, meaning she doesn't teach Music. Mrs. Karels sits between Ms. Merridy and Mrs. Strain (ELA), and one of them can carry a tune. That person has to be Ms. Merridy (Music) because Mrs. Strain already has a subject assigned to her. Now we have two teachers left, Mr. Holman and Mrs. Karels, one of which teaches Science and the other has an unspecified subject. Ms. Karels can't teach Science because the Science teacher sits between Mrs. Strain (ELA) and Mrs. Bailey (Spanish) and Ms. Karels sits between Mrs. Strain (ELA) and Ms. Merridy (Music), therefore the Science teacher is Mr. Holman (Science).

What is a Lawyer?A person who prepares, interprets, and applies the law as an advocate, attorney at law, barrister, barrister-at-law, solicitor, canonist, canon lawyer, legal executive, or public servant—but not as a paralegal or chartered executive secretary—is referred to as a lawyer or attorney.
In reality, legal jurisdictions utilize their authority to choose who is admitted to practice as a lawyer. As a result, the definition of the word "lawyer" may differ depending on where you are. Barristers and solicitors are two different legal professions in certain countries, whereas they are combined in others.
A lawyer who focuses on appearing in higher courts is known as a barrister. A solicitor is a type of lawyer qualified to prepare cases, provide legal advice, and represent clients in lower courts. Both solicitors and barristers have graduated from law school and acquired the necessary practical experience. However, only barristers are allowed to join their individual bar organizations in jurisdictions where there is a split profession.
